Dive into the remarkable life and career of Daniil Medvedev, one of the most unconventional and electrifying tennis players of his generation. Hosted by Tye Morgan on the Biography Flash podcast network, this show delivers a thoroughly researched, in-depth biography of the man known as The Bear, from his childhood in Moscow to his rise as a Grand Slam champion, world number one, and one of the few players to break the historic stranglehold of the Big Four on men's tennis. Discover how a kid who picked up a racket at nine years old, never advanced past the third round of a junior Grand Slam, and left Russia at eighteen to train in France built himself into one of the most tenacious competitors in the sport. From his explosive 2019 breakout season and that unforgettable five-set US Open final against Rafael Nadal to his dominant straight-sets triumph over Novak Djokovic at the 2021 US Open, his six Masters 1000 titles, his Davis Cup victory, and his ascent to the ATP number one ranking, every chapter of Medvedev's journey is covered in vivid detail.
